So I was just practicing this new thing I found, and it is kind of awesome. When you're recovering low, you can toss an egg to sweetspot the ledge, which is nice, but your move has no priority, so it is risky if you get hit. If you option select a tech the moment you hit UpB, you will throw the egg, and be able to tech the stage if you get hit. While you're throwing the egg/getting hit, SDI into the stage with quarter circle DI, and end by going up, to jump out of the tech. Finally, airdodge to cancel the momentum of your jump, into landing on stage.
Summary: go for UpB sweetspot, as you toss egg hit R then SDI in, airdodge onte stage after tech.
The egg will still come out, and can hit your opponent.
This is something I would use if your opponent charges smashes to edgeguard you.
